Have-a-go Days

You can come to Whitemark Bowmen and find out about the sport of Field Archery. The Have-a-go days are run on selected Saturdays throughout the year and are open to anyone over the age of seven. See the shoot calendar for the actual dates. The day starts at 10 o'clock with a safety briefing which you must attend. You may stay as long as you like, up til 2pm. See the programme below.

You will learn about the club and its shooting range and be shown how to shoot safely. We have special training bows for beginners of all ages and other, more powerful bows if you would like to progress. The equipment and instruction are provided free but to cover insurance and expenses like broken arrows, there is a small charge of £4 for adults and £2 for children. By law, children must be accompanied by an adult.

Clothing

You will be out in the woods for most of the time so dress appropriately for the weather but avoid loose or really bulky garments. It can be damp or muddy underfoot so wear trainers or walking boots.

Programme

TimeActivityContent
10:00What is Field Archery?A basic description of the objectives and procedures
10:05Introduction and safetyYou will find out about Whitemark Bowmen and the field archery association structure, and be given essential safety information.
10:15Archery equipmentArchery is not just bows and arrows, there are other important accessories that you will be shown.
10:20StylesThere is an enormous variety of bows available but in field archery they are grouped into styles that will be described and shown to you.
10:25RoundsYou will find out about rounds and how the targets and scoring differ.
10:30Getting readyYou will find out about right/left eye dominance and be fitted out with a suitable bow and accessories
10:40Group basic instructionIn groups you will be shown how to stand, hold a bow, load an arrow, draw back the string, aim and release the shot. The instructor will remind you of the safety procedures and show you how and when to recover arrows.
11:00Individual instructionYou will receive individual attention to ensure that your technique is correct and safe, and have time to practice and improve.
11:30Round the courseThis is your chance to see the full course and shoot a selection of the targets. You will also learn about the procedures and course etiquette.
til 2pmYou chooseArchery can be quite tiring but you might like to stay and do some more or try a different bow. We could also explain more about the sport and the EFAA incentives and awards. You might like to discuss membership or even sign up.
